IMD issued a yellow alert to Hyderabad

Hyderabad : Indian Meteorological Department (IMD), issued a yellow alert to Hyderabad for Thursday. The city is expected to see generally cloudy skies over the next 48 hours.

In districts, including Mahabubnagar, Rangareddy, Vikarabad, Sangareddy, and Nizamabad also saw scattered moderate downpours. A yellow alert has been issued across various districts in Telangana, remaining in effect until August 25.

Officials are on high alert, with disaster response teams prepared to assist in any critical situations.
